Доступ к сайту заблокирован для определенных браузеров
397
Sherwood Botsford
Я получаю этот экран выше при доступе к http://www.nait.ca из Chrome, но не из Firefox.
Я получаю этот экран на четырех разных компьютерах под управлением Mac Yosemite и трех браузерах Chrome, Safari, curl
curl -k (переходите с небезопасных сертификатов) работает.
Пробовал перезагрузить роутер. Без изменений.
Дополнительная информация * Бывает и в инкогнито окнах. * Бывает на 4 разных компьютерах с разными пользователями и наборами расширений. * Происходит в двух разных ОС * Происходит в 4 из 5 браузеров.
Не происходит, когда мой племянник в Оттаве заходит на сайт с помощью Chrome в Windows или Safari на iPhone.
Я получаю то же сообщение (в тексте), если я использую curl.
Как и почему Chrome должен быть заблокирован, но не Firefox.
После публикации я увидел, что у меня есть ответы на вопрос об академии.
Я подозреваю, что оба связаны. Еще раз, это нормально на Firefox.
3 ответа на вопрос
2
davidgo
Этот сервер использует Azure и выглядит так, как будто он сбалансирован по нагрузке. Скорее всего, один (или несколько) узлов перегружены и больше не обрабатывают запросы.
Возможно / вероятно, что они выполняют маршрутизацию на основе файлов cookie / сеансов, и ваши разные браузеры используют разные файлы cookie, поэтому они используют разные системы. Короче говоря, это проблема SERVER, и один или несколько серверов в кластере серверов имеют проблему.
Это была моя первая мысль, и в других обстоятельствах это хорошая идея (следовательно, upvote.) Однако, если бы это было так, это не сработало бы на firefox, и у людей за пределами моей локальной сети также возникла бы проблема.
Sherwood Botsford 6 лет назад
0
Попробуйте найти плагин для изменения пользовательского агента и посмотрите, исправит ли это проблему. Возможно, это комбинация диапазона IP-адресов и маршрутизации для определенных строк браузера. То, что вы получаете синий экран с белой надписью из Azure, указывает, что это проблема на стороне сервера (или преднамеренное действие)
davidgo 6 лет назад
0
1
Nurudin Imsirovic
Одной из возможных причин может быть то, что вы используете настройки прокси для локальных адресов. Для решения проблемы выполните следующие действия:
Перейдите в Настройки Chrome -> Настройки -> Нажмите Показать дополнительные настройки -> Сеть -> Нажмите Изменить настройки прокси -> Настройки локальной сети -> Включить обходной прокси-сервер для локального адреса.
Чтобы получить более четкое представление, пожалуйста, посмотрите на скриншот.
На маке это не так выложено. Прокси находится под системой, и открытие настроек прокси вызывает системные настройки. Попытка понять, как это повлияет на несколько компьютеров, но только на один браузер.
Sherwood Botsford 6 лет назад
0
Прокси не установлены. Включен обход обхода для локального, вместе с 169.254 / 16
Sherwood Botsford 6 лет назад
0
Перейдите в chrome: // extensions и проверьте, есть ли какие-либо расширения, которые имеют более высокие привилегии, чем другие, например, те, которые имеют расширения типа «Можно получить доступ к URL» и «Изменить то, что вы видите».
Nurudin Imsirovic 6 лет назад
0
Бывает и в инкогнито окнах. Бывает на 4 разных компьютерах с разными пользователями и наборами расширений. Происходит на двух разных ОС
Sherwood Botsford 6 лет назад
0
Вы пытались перезагрузить маршрутизатор с IP-адреса маршрутизатора?
Nurudin Imsirovic 6 лет назад
0
Попробовал это. Без изменений.
Sherwood Botsford 6 лет назад
0
Любой шанс, что ваш провайдер заблокировал сайт по любой причине. Вы пробовали VPN только для проверки?
Nurudin Imsirovic 6 лет назад
0
0
Sherwood Botsford
Один компьютер используется в качестве сервера кэширования DNS с использованием pdnsd. Наш маршрутизатор передает адрес этих компьютеров для 8 компьютеров нашей домашней сети. Проблема исчезла после перезагрузки этого компьютера.
Я не смог повторить проблему.
В следующий раз:
Проверьте, какие IP-адреса показывает проблемный веб-сайт. Повторите это между шагами, чтобы увидеть, если это изменится.
Остановись и запусти pdnsd.
Очистить кеш psnsd. (р для постоянных - он запоминает последние 10000 или около того. Я настроил агрессивную политику кэширования, чтобы компенсировать очень медленную интернет-связь.
Эта теория даже не приходила мне в голову, пока мне не понадобилось перезагружать этот компьютер по другим причинам.